Creamy Greek Yogurt Herb Marinated Chicken Thighs

Enjoy tender, juicy chicken thighs marinated in a creamy blend of Greek yogurt, fresh lemon juice, garlic, and a medley of herbs. This dish brings a delightful balance of tangy and savory flavors, perfect for a nourishing and satisfying meal.

NUTRITION

354kcal
Protein
41.3g
Fat
18.5g
Carbs
4.1g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

1 piece (8 oz) Chicken Thigh (Boneless, Skinless)

1/4 cup Plain Nonfat Greek Yogurt

1 teaspoon Extra Virgin Olive Oil

1 clove Garlic, minced

1 tablespoon Lemon Juice

1 tablespoon Fresh Mixed Herbs (Parsley, Dill)

Salt and Black Pepper to taste

PREPARATION

  • 1

    In a bowl, whisk together the Greek yogurt, olive oil, lemon juice, minced garlic, chopped herbs, salt, and pepper to create the marinade.

  • 2

    Place the chicken thigh in a resealable plastic bag or shallow dish and pour the marinade over it, ensuring an even coating. Seal or cover and refrigerate for at least 2 hours for best flavor, or overnight if possible.

  • 3

    Preheat your grill or oven to 400°F. If grilling, lightly oil the grates to prevent sticking.

  • 4

    Remove the chicken from the marinade, allowing excess to drip off. Grill or bake the chicken thigh for about 20-25 minutes, turning once halfway through, until the internal temperature reaches 165°F.

  • 5

    Let the chicken rest for a few minutes before serving to allow juices to redistribute. Enjoy your flavorful, creamy herb marinated chicken thigh as a satisfying meal.
